Running services Allows you to view and control currently
running services and applications. This option displays what
processes each running service needs and how much memory it
is using.

USB debugging Permits debugging tools on a computer to
communicate with your phone via a USB connection.
Stay awake Allows you to set the phone to prevent the screen
from dimming and locking when it is connected to a charger or
to a USB device that provides power. Don't use this setting
with a static image on the phone for long periods of time, or
the screen may be marked with that image.
Allow mock locations Permits a development tool on a
computer to control where the phone believes it is located,
rather than using the phone's own internal tools for this
purpose.
